Four Russian scientists will be at the Medical School and the School of Public Health today for Russia's first inspection of Salk vaccine.
Members of the group include the director of the Russian Poliomyelitis Research and some of the Institute's top research workers. Both the State Department and the Public Health Service have been arranging their tour.
At Harvard the Russians, studying the treatment of polio, will visit Thomas H. Weller, Richard Strong Professor of Public Health, Albert H. Coone, Visiting Professor of Bacteriology, and Monree D. Eston, professor of Bacteriology.
